Across TCGA patient cohorts, NPC2 protein abundance is significantly associated with the RNA expression of many other genes, with 18,058 significant associations in total. GBM shows the largest number of these associations.

The most reproducible NPC2-associated genes across cancer lineages are OIP5, IGSF6, and CD300LF. Each is linked with NPC2 in more than 5 cancer types. Because this analysis shows association rather than direction, both NPC2-to-partner and partner-to-NPC2 results are reported.

Each partner links to its own Q-omics profile. The scatter plot shows the strongest example, NPC2 versus OIP5 in LSCC, with a Pearson correlation of -0.50.
